Tehuantepec Isthmus, interoceanic route, journeys, lodgings, “Louisiana Tehuantepec Company”Abstract
An old dream about a route through the Tehuantepec Isthmus, which linked the Gulf of Mexico and the Pacific Ocean, came true between 1858 and 1860, when American entrepreneurs set up a new business including steamboats, wagons and carriages, mules and horses, round trip transportation for travelers, freight and mail. The dream did not last long, but this route attracted businessmen, speculators, technicians and immigrants who wanted to get to California and benefit from the gold findings. This work deals with the itinerary and its stages, approaching travelers through the few existing testimonies, many of which belong to the press, both Mexican and American, because this issue has not been entered upon academically.
